Hello,

I created a bill in Acumatica 2020/R1 and am trying to retrieve it via the Contract-Based REST API. I’ve tried with and without parameters like this:

GET https://acumatica-dev.psfc.coop/entity/Default/18.200.001//Bill?$select=Date,Amount,ReferenceNbr,Vendor,VendorRef,Details/Description,Details/UnitCost,Details/Qty,Details/Amount,Details/Account&$expand=Details

and this:
GET https://acumatica-dev.psfc.coop/entity/Default/18.200.001//Bill

I get back a 200 response and empty array [] in the body.

Can anyone please help me with this?
